About the Dive Animals Scuba ClubWhere to begin....

The Dive Animals originally started out in 1984 as the Convair Scuba Club and was setup for General Dynamics employees. It was subsidized by the company and over the next 6 years two inflatable Zodiac style boats were purchased.  In 1990 General Dynamics was shrinking fast, and by 1993 it had sold off its divisions that were located in San Diego.

With no longer any corporate sponsorship, John Ellerbrock decided to run the club as a standalone non-profit and after incorporating with the state and securing insurance the Convair Scuba Club was reformed as the Dive Animals Scuba Club. 

Since 1993 the DASC has been one of the cornerstones of the San Diego diving scene.

The club always maintains at least one dive boat and this makes it unique compared to other local clubs."
